Resumo: | The Function-as-a-Service (FaaS) service model has aroused great interest since its introduction in the context of cloud computing. Although FaaS can be used to perform isolated tasks, it is in the composition of applications that this service model can promote significant performance improvements. This work presents an evolution in the Node2FaaS framework, whose objective is to assist in the conversion of originally monolithic node.js applications to work with FaaS in the Remote Procedure Call (RPC) communication mechanism. The new implementations in the Node2FaaS framework allowed new experiments to be conducted. Those showed significant gains in runtime for applications with CPU-bound, memory-bound, I/O-bound characteristics, especially for a Bioinformatics application that aims to align genetic sequences. |
